This project focuses on creating and testing peptide-transition metal catalysts to develop selective catalysts for nano-medicines. By synthesizing organozyme molecules that mimic enzymes, the project aims to improve drug delivery and efficacy, particularly for treating conditions like Alzheimer's disease.
Here is proposed nano-scale synthesis and combinatorial screening of medium sized peptide-transition metal catalyst libraries with the aim of producing libraries for screening highly selective catalysts for development of nano-medicines.
The implementation of catalytic molecules as medicines is a new paradigm in treatment that can overcome a number of the difficulties with present drugs.
